Workflow map

The operating path should be visible before anyone trusts the outcome.

Folium uses workflow maps to turn broad AI ambition into inspectable work. Each phase names the procedure, the visible output, and the decision gate that prevents excitement from outrunning control.

Decision gridReview lensNext step
PhaseProcedureVisible outputDecision gate
Cost the current workMeasure labor time, rework, delays, support load, error cost, missed revenue, and customer friction.Current-state cost map.The workflow has measurable economic pressure.
Define the useful outputName what AI must retrieve, classify, draft, route, validate, summarize, notify, or prepare for approval.Useful-output definition.Output is tied to work, not novelty.
Select the system routeCompare focused model, RAG, local CPU-capable path, private endpoint, rules-assisted agent, cloud model, or hybrid route.Right-size route matrix.The smallest capable route is justified.
Exploit existing capacityCheck whether current hardware, local CPU lanes, browser-adjacent tools, databases, or existing software can carry part of the workload.Existing-capacity worksheet.The customer does not buy unnecessary infrastructure.
Design a model cascadeRoute easy work to rules, retrieval, caches, small models, or focused models before escalating to larger models for hard cases.Model cascade policy.Large-model usage is reserved for work that needs it.
Reduce recurring costAdd caching, batching, prompt reuse, retrieval, tool routing, rate limits, quota alerts, and fallback lanes.Cost-control design.Repeated work does not become repeated waste.
Gate authorityKeep expensive, sensitive, customer-facing, or state-changing actions human-reviewed until records justify expansion.Authority gate map.Autonomy does not outrun economics or trust.
Tie work to revenueIdentify where AI can recover missed leads, improve follow-up, reduce returns, speed quote response, improve content quality, or prevent customer churn.Revenue-recovery map.AI is measured against value created, not only cost avoided.
Measure the resultTrack cost per useful output, cycle time, quality, rework, support load, revenue recovery, and next improvement.AI profitability ledger.The build can prove whether it should expand.
Improve or retireTune, simplify, cache, reroute, replace, localize, scale, or retire AI lanes based on value and cost evidence.Improvement decision record.The system earns its place each cycle.

Procedures

The procedure is the product as much as the technology.

The goal is not to make AI look impressive for one meeting. The goal is to make the operating path repeatable, explainable, reviewable, and safe enough to improve.

ChecklistOwner pathRelease signal
  • Do not start with a general model when the business has not named the work.
  • Choose the smallest capable model or route that can perform the task safely.
  • Use focused models, RAG, rules, tools, and local CPU-capable lanes where they fit the job.
  • Reserve larger frontier models for tasks that actually need broad reasoning, language quality, or complex synthesis.
  • Route easy work through deterministic logic, retrieval, cached answers, small models, or focused models before escalating to expensive routes.
  • Check whether existing hardware or software can carry the first lane before recommending new infrastructure.
  • Cache repeated answers, prompts, retrieval results, and workflow decisions where safe.
  • Batch and schedule non-urgent AI work instead of paying premium runtime costs for everything.
  • Measure cost per useful output, not only token volume or chat count.
  • Tie every AI lane to a workflow owner and a business metric.
  • Track revenue recovered, churn avoided, faster response, better quality, and customer confidence in addition to labor savings.
  • Keep human gates on expensive, sensitive, customer-facing, or state-changing actions.
  • Retire, simplify, or reroute AI lanes that do not earn their operating cost.

Controls

Governance, quality, and launch gates keep speed honest.

Folium keeps the buyer's next decision tied to observable gates: source truth, authority, access, testing, ownership, support, rollback, and improvement cadence.

Decision gridReview lensNext step
GateWhat must be trueStop or refine signal
Work gateThe workflow, owner, current cost, and useful output are named.AI is being added because it is fashionable.
Route gateThe model/runtime choice is justified by task, risk, cost, latency, privacy, and support.Everything routes to the largest model by default.
Existing-capacity gateCurrent hardware, CPU lanes, databases, or owned tools were checked before new spend was added.The customer buys new infrastructure before proving need.
Cascade gateEasy tasks route to lower-cost lanes before expensive models are used.Large-model calls become the default path.
Cost gateExpected usage, recurring cost, cache opportunities, alerts, and thresholds are visible.The system can spend silently.
Value gateThe system measures saved time, avoided rework, revenue recovery, quality, or risk reduction.No one can tell if the AI paid for itself.
Authority gateHuman approval, rollback, and blocked actions exist for costly or risky behavior.AI can create expensive mistakes without review.
Retirement gateThere is a path to simplify, localize, cache, merge, pause, or shut down low-value lanes.AI becomes overhead forever.

Risk and assumption register

The hidden assumptions should be visible before they become expensive.

Every AI engagement contains assumptions about data, people, systems, cost, behavior, and authority. Folium treats those assumptions as review material, not background noise.

Decision gridReview lensNext step
AssumptionWhy it mattersHow Folium reviews it
The source is authoritativeAI can only be as reliable as the sources and business rules it is allowed to use.Source inventory, owner confirmation, retrieval tests, freshness cadence.
The process is readyA broken process can become a faster broken process when AI is added too early.Workflow mapping, bottleneck review, owner interview, first-lane narrowing.
The runtime fits the dataCloud, private, local, and hybrid routes carry different privacy, cost, latency, and support tradeoffs.Runtime matrix, data classification, provider review, fallback plan.
Staff will adopt the toolAdoption fails when users do not understand, trust, correct, or benefit from the system.Training notes, staff review, feedback loop, manager visibility.
Authority is clearThe system can create harm if it sends, updates, approves, or routes without permission.Permission table, blocked actions, human review, audit trail.
The system can be supportedA useful first build becomes fragile if nobody owns incidents, source updates, or cost review.Support guide, owner map, release rhythm, rollback trigger.
